As for dead bodies, go to a thrift store like Goodwill to get some cheap clothes to bloody up or find clothes you don't want anymore and then stuff them with plastic bags or other stuff to fill out the clothes to make bodies. Then if you have masks use them for the heads. Or make headless people as if some crazy psycho killed the people and cut off their heads. Just put blood near the necks. maybe that spray styrofoam and then blood so it looks like their guts. =)

Setting up your yard haunt can be a little tuff but once you get started the creative juices will just flow! I would plan out what you want to do first... cemetery theme, haunted house, cornfield, etc. and maybe a small sketch to see where this and that could go. If you don't have very many props this year, don't worry... spend a dollar or two on lighting FX. This can and will, make or break your yard haunt... just the dollar store basic props can look great at night time lit up with some colored CFL or LEDs (even colored spot lamps). Try to layer the colors (i.e. background, foreground and spot light your main props). You will be surprised how this will look!
